2005 Fiat Stilo vs. 1968 Mini MK II
To start off, 2005 Fiat Stilo is newer by 37 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1968 Mini MK II.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1968 Mini MK II would be higher. At 1,596 cc (4 cylinders), 2005 Fiat Stilo is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Fiat Stilo (99 HP @ 5750 RPM) has 65 more horse power than 1968 Mini MK II. (34 HP @ 5500 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Fiat Stilo should accelerate faster than 1968 Mini MK II.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Fiat Stilo weights approximately 656 kg more than 1968 Mini MK II.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Fiat Stilo (145 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 84 more torque (in Nm) than 1968 Mini MK II. (61 Nm @ 2900 RPM). This means 2005 Fiat Stilo will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1968 Mini MK II.
Compare all specifications:
2005 Fiat Stilo | 1968 Mini MK II | |
Make | Fiat | Mini |
Model | Stilo | MK II |
Year Released | 2005 | 1968 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1596 cc | 848 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Valves per Cylinder | 4 valves | 2 valves |
Horse Power | 99 HP | 34 HP |
Engine RPM | 5750 RPM | 5500 RPM |
Torque | 145 Nm | 61 Nm |
Torque RPM | 4000 RPM | 2900 RPM |
Drive Type | Front | Front |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Vehicle Weight | 1266 kg | 610 kg |
Wheelbase Size | 2610 mm | 2040 mm |
